body {font-size: 65%;}

a:hover{text-decoration: underline;}

.banner {font-family: verdana, arial, sans-serif; font-weight: bold; font-size: .9em;}
.banner a{text-decoration: none; color: #CCC;}
.banner a:hover{text-decoration: underline; color: #FFF;}

.menu {font-size: .8em; text-decoration: none; color: #FFF; font-family: verdana, arial, sans-serif;}

#story {float: left; width: 520px; padding: 15px; margin: 0; font-family: Georgia, Times, serif; line-height: 1.6em; color: #933; font-size: .9em; border-top-width: 0; border-right-width: 1px; border-bottom-width: 0; border-left-width: 0; border-style: solid; border-color: #FFF;}

#sidebar {position: absolute; float: right; top: 175px; width: 180px;}
.caption {padding-left: 6px; font-family: verdana, arial, sans-serif; font-size: .7em; color: #666;}

.pages {font-family: verdana, arial, sans-serif; font-size: .8em; color: #999;}
.pages a{text-decoration: none; color: #333; font-weight: bold;}